What happens to a cat after being abused?
If a cat has been systematically abused, it will be psychologically scarred. Traumatic events form part of a cat’s long-term memory and stay with the cat forever. The cat will never forget its ordeal but may be prepared to forgive abuse if given enough time.

Do cats hold grudges?
Cat’s aren’t capable of holding grudges as humans understand them. Grudges involve a confluence of complex emotions that cats can’t feel. Your cat may remember specific events and dislike them though only for a short time. Researchers say a cat’s memory span for specific events only lasts 16 hours at most.

How long does it take for an abused cat to recover?
First of all, don’t expect things to turn around overnight and do not have too high expectations for the final result. It often takes a year to transform a reclusive, abused cat into a family-friendly companion. Even so, do not expect a miracle: You are unlikely to achieve complete resolution of the issues.
